Hi,
I am in process of applying for OCI, after submitting the application when you upload the documents, I have uploaded the following:
Current Passport (Canadian Passport)
Employment/ Work Letter
Marriage Certificate
Spouse Passport (Current Canadian Passport)
Indian Origin Proof (Last Indian Passport which got cancelled during the time of surrender)
There are still a few sections displayed in drop down for uploading documents which either I don't have or I don't know what to upload. If anyone could please guide me on what to do with below section to upload documents:
Indian Visa
Joint Declaration of Subsisting of Marriage
PIO Card
Relationship Certificate (I did mention my parents living in India as Relatives in India, is this relevant?)
Spouse OCI Card (Don’t have it, she is also applying with me)
This is enough from document uploading perspective.
But don't forget to carry your and your spouse's landing papers(COPR) with you. BLS people may surprise you sometimes, so it is always good to carry all the originals with you.

Last minute of OCI submission, I need clarity. Can someone help.
On the OCI Ottawa checklist I do not see anywhere it states that the document needs to be translated.
My daughter Birth certificate was issued in Quebec 4 years back and it is fully french in both long form and short form. Do I need to make it a certified translation? I am going to the Montreal office 30th June Morning before opening time.
Anyone from Montreal with a French Birth certificate successfully submitted the OCI?
Zero Issues i faced, they took all applications, and we got our OCI in September First week Around.
I just gave the Copy of the Canadian (Quebec issued French) Birth ceritifcate , no questions asked. it has been 8 motnhs since i got my OCI, ia m not sure if there is any change in the process.

Hey bud, at what stage do they share the Purolator tracking for in-person applications with individuals who opted for courier services? Or is it not shared?
When the status on the BLS site changes to "Ready for Dispatch" you would see the Purolator tracking# mentioned
If that is not posted search on Purolator website with your Application# CANTxxxx as a reference
